 DAVID BOHMS 'S HOLOKINESIS: the BLOCK UNIVERSE 2.0?


Einstein’s 4D Block Universe

Einstein’s Special and General Relativity leads directly to the Block Universe model (also known as Eternalism), which states that the past, present, and future all exist simultaneously within a four-dimensional spacetime continuum.

In standard relativistic physics, space and time are fused into a single four-dimensional manifold ($x, y, z, t$).

Just as a location in space doesn't vanish simply because you walk away from it, points in time do not cease to exist when they slide into the "past. The Big Bang, the extinction of the dinosaurs, "your" birth, this exact moment, and the far future all exist permanently as fixed geometric coordinates inside a static 4D "loaf" of spacetime.


Bohm’s Holokinesis: Dynamic Enfoldment

David Bohm’s theory of Holokinesis is fully compatible with the Block Universe atemporal view of reality, but it interprets how this simultaneity exists in a more dynamic way.

In Bohm’s framework, the Universe does not sit passively spread out across a temporal grid. Instead, the entire Universe - past, present, and potential future - is enfolded within the unitary undivided whole at every moment and contains everything in an eternal now.

Bohm agrees that temporal succession is an explicate illusion, but he rejects the idea that fundamental reality is merely a frozen, static 4D block. In the Holomovement (Holokinesis), simultaneity functions differently:

  • Enfolded Simultaneity: The past, present, and future exist simultaneously because they are enfolded within the Implicate Order—much like multiple overlapping interference patterns encoded on a single holographic plate.

  • Continuous Projection: What we experience as the "passage of time" is the Holomovement continuously unfolding information out of the timeless implicate matrix into explicit localized form, and then enfolding it back in.

  • The Past as Active Memory: In Bohm's view, the past is not a point sitting behind us on a timeline; it is an active, enfolded trace in the Implicate Order, which is always present. The future exists as an enfolded set of structural potentials waiting to project.
